The Nigerian Senate on Tuesday accused some functionaries in the administration of President Muhammadu Buhari of rubbishing the anti – corruption crusade of the current government.

They queried why Abdulrasheed Maina, the ex – chairman of the defunct Presidential Task Force on Pension Reforms who absconded from service as assistant director could be discreetly reinstated into the nation’s civil service as a director.

The senators therefore set up an ad hoc committee to investigate the circumstances surrounding the reinstatement of Maina who is said to have gone into hiding soon after the news of his reinstatement went into the public domain.

Senate President, Dr. Bukola Saraki said that the members of the committee would include the Chairman and Vice Chairman of the Senate committees on Interior, Judiciary and Anti – Corruption while it would be headed by the Chairman, Senate Committee on Establishment and Public Service Matters, Senator Aloysius Akpan Etok.
